McCain Food has said it is preparing to launch McCain Waffles as part of a drive to deliver brand growth.
“The new product launch ensures McCain Foods can offer mums, its core consumer, a range of nutritious and great tasting potato products that all children can enjoy, whatever their age,” McCain said.
McCain brand head Mark Hodge said the move would capitalise on a demand for potato waffles that is already present in the UK market. “For years consumers have believed that a McCain Waffle already exists, frequently talking about it in consumer research. The launch coincides with McCain’s GBP35m (US$56.5m) “Happy Days” marketing programme, which consists of a year-long run of marketing activity that the company said is meant to drive category growth by “transforming” the McCain brand.
